Physical Symptoms

Deformity

A state of being deformed, disfigured, etc

Constipation

A condition of the bowels in which the feces are dry and hardened and evacuation is difficult and infrequent

Physical Symptoms

Bruise

An injury to underlying tissues or bone in which the skin is unbroken, often characterized by ruptured blood vessels and discolourations

Swelling

An abnormal enlargement of a bodily structure or part, esp. as the result of injury

Physical Symptoms

Nausea

A feeling of sickness in the stomach marked by an urge to vomit

Numbness

Not being able to move

Itch

an unpleasant feeling on your skin that makes you want to scratch

Dizziness

Faintness, light-headedness or unsteadiness

What is Academic Writing?

Formality

academics

family and friends

serious thought

conversational

complex sentences showing considerable variety in construction

mostly simple and compound sentences joined by conjunctions such as and or but

clear and well planned

less likely to be clear and as organised

likely to be error free

may not always use complete sentences

Technical and academic language used accurately

use of short forms, idioms and slang

Academic writing: more complex

In terms of formality and grammatical structures

Formality of language:

  • big differences vs most significant distinction

*Word choice to convey a high level of formality

look into the issue vs examine the issue

talk about vs discuss

come up with some possible solutions vs

suggest some possible solutions
